找到
11
篇与
备忘录
相关的结果
-
一键使用远程火狐浏览器来上Google来查收录情况 🦊 火狐浏览器还能这么玩?在服务器上跑个远程版,真香!🔥 大家熟知的 Firefox(火狐),其实还可以塞进服务器里,通过 VNC 远程访问。 简单说就是:你控制的是一个住在云端的浏览器 🌐 原仓库地址 下载地址:https://github.com/jlesage/docker-firefox 提取码: ❓ 这玩意儿能干吗?为啥不直接用电脑浏览器? 好问题!一开始我也觉得多此一举,直到发现一个神仙用法: 如果你的服务器在境外,那这个远程火狐就可以直连 Google, 不需要任何 VPN、代理,嗖的一下就能打开Google 搜索、Google Console, 检查博客收录、看 Search Console 数据,就跟在本地用一样丝滑~ 💨 mljjpbi3.png图片 👉 相当于你拥有一个永不关机的海外浏览器,随时掏出来用 VNC 连上去干活! 🚀 一键 Run 起来 先把容器环境准备好,然后执行下面这行命令 👇 docker run -d \ --name=firefox \ -p 5800:5800 \ -v /docker/appdata/firefox:/config:rw \ -e ENABLE_CJK_FONT=1 \ -e LANG=zh_CN.UTF-8 \ jlesage/firefox🧩 参数都是干啥的?拆开看看! 参数作用备注-e TZ=Asia/Hong_Kong设置时区避免时间错乱 🕒-e DISPLAY_WIDTH=1920 -e DISPLAY_HEIGHT=1080分辨率想要 4K?自己改数字~-e KEEP_APP_RUNNING=1保持运行关了浏览器窗口也不退出 ✅-e ENABLE_CJK_FONT=1中文字体支持告别乱码,舒服看中文 📝-e LANG=zh_CN.UTF-8界面语言设置成中文(舒服!)-e SECURE_CONNECTION=1启用 HTTPSWeb 访问更安全 🔒-e VNC_PASSWORD=adminVNC 密码自己改个复杂点的!-p 5800:5800HTTP 访问端口浏览器里打开网页版界面 🌍-p 5900:5900VNC 端口用 VNC 客户端连上来-v /data/firefox/config:/config:rw挂载配置目录书签、密码全存下来,重启不丢 💾--shm-size 2g共享内存跑复杂页面不卡,给足 2G 🧠🛡️ 防火墙小贴士 如果你只想本机访问,不想暴露到公网,可以把端口映射改成: -p 127.0.0.1:5800:5800 这样只有服务器自己才能连,更安全 👍 🎉 最后说两句 这种“云端火狐”其实还有很多玩法: 跑自动化脚本(搭配 Selenium) 多人共享一个浏览器环境 临时需要一个干净的浏览器,不想装软件 总之,一旦用上就回不去了 😎 你也赶紧试试吧,有问题欢迎留言交流~ -
把1panel的Docker 导出到宝塔的Docker 🐳 救命!从1panel搬家到宝塔,Docker折腾死我了!😫 今天也不知道哪根筋搭错了🤪,看着1panel那个面板越看越不顺眼,突然就想:换!马上换宝塔! 💢 📦 第一步:从1panel导出 1️⃣ 打开你的1panel面板 2️⃣ 找到 容器 → 更多 → 制作镜像 mli08umo.png图片 3️⃣ 【敲黑板!重点来了!】 🚨 1.点开 容器 → 更多 → 数据卷 2.找到挂载点,瞅一眼存档位置在哪 👀 3.然后——把所有数据卷全部压缩下载导出! 一个都别落下!💾 mli06g35.png图片 💡 别问我为啥要这一步,问就是踩过坑了😭🚚 第二步:宝塔那边怎么搞? 1️⃣ 打开你的宝塔面板 2️⃣ Docker → 镜像 → 导入镜像(把刚刚1panel导出的镜像扔进去) mli0f080.png图片 3️⃣ 创建容器 —— 这一步应该不用教了吧?🤔 4️⃣ 【第二个重点!拿小本本记下来!】 📝 Docker → 存储卷 🔍 找到你那个项目的地址 开一个新窗口,文件管理直接输入路径 mli079po.png图片 把1panel导出的文件,一股脑全覆盖进去! 💪 mli0851e.png图片 5️⃣ 【最后一步!】 重启!重启!重启! 重要的事情说三遍!🔄 🎉 搞定! 折腾了一下午,终于搞定了... 看着宝塔那个熟悉的面板,突然觉得——还是原来的配方,还是熟悉的味道~ 🥰 📌 划重点总结: ✅ 1panel导出:镜像 + 数据卷 ✅ 宝塔导入:镜像 → 容器 → 覆盖存储卷 → 重启 ❌ 别偷懒只导镜像,不然数据没了哭都来不及😱 🤔 等等,我好像悟了... 话说回来,宝塔导1panel,1panel导宝塔,不都是Docker吗? 这玩意儿难道还能有差别?🧐 💣 其实真相是这样的 很多人(包括博主本人)一开始都以为: Docker镜像 = Ghost备份 💿Ghost: 整个C盘给你端走,注册表、文档、桌面壁纸、甚至你八百年前忘删的迅雷安装包,全在里面躺着。 Docker镜像: 呵,想多了🙃 你只是把“刚装好系统的那一刻”打包了。 你后来存的论文📄、下的电影🎬、浏览器收藏夹🔖,全在另一个分区——也就是数据卷里,压根没跟你走。 🔄 所以正确的搬家姿势其实是: 🏠 1panel → 宝塔 1panel端: ✅ 导出镜像 ✅ 导出存储卷 宝塔端: ✅ 导入镜像 ✅ 导入存储卷 🏢 宝塔 → 1panel 反过来也一样: ✅ 宝塔导出镜像 ✅ 宝塔导出存储卷 ✅ 1panel导入镜像 ✅ 1panel导入存储卷 -
【AI】使用deepseek来美化你的文章/GitHub的README ✨ 一句话魔法:让AI瞬间美化你的Markdown博客! 还在为博客排版头疼吗?手动调整格式、绞尽脑汁想生动表达的日子结束啦!🎉 现在,只需一句神奇指令,就能让你的DeepSeek助手帮忙搞定一切,简直像拥有了一个专属排版小精灵!🧚♂️ 🤔 为什么要让AI帮忙美化? 省时省力 ⏰:再也不用花费大量时间手动调整格式、寻找合适的Emoji。 风格统一 🎨:AI能让你的文章风格更一致,阅读体验Up!Up! 灵感激发 💡:那些你没想到的生动表达和趣味元素,AI可能帮你“变”出来。 专注内容 ✍️:你可以更专注于思考要写的内容,而不是纠结怎么写好看。 🪄 那句“神奇指令”是什么? 核心指令其实很简单,就像下面这样(没错,就是你现在看到的这篇文章所使用的“魔法”✨): 帮我把一下博客文章美化一下,然后转成Markdown.md格式,口语化一点,不要AI味浓烈,要带有emoji,,并且使用代码块的方式给我,注意必须使用代码块包裹博客文章原格式,你准备好了就告诉我:“我已经准备好了”, -
解决Windows存储池无法创建的问题 解决 Windows 存储池“无法添加驱动器”问题 你是否在 Windows 中创建存储池时,遇到过这个令人头疼的错误提示? “无法添加驱动器。检查驱动器连接,然后重试。” ml7ygwcb.png图片反复检查线缆和接口,驱动器明明被系统识别,却始终无法加入存储池。如果你正受此困扰,那么本篇教程或许正是你需要的解决方案。 📌 问题根源分析 根据经验,这个问题大概率是由于你此前曾创建过存储池,但后来通过第三方工具(如 DiskGenius、分区助手等)或命令行手动删除了硬盘上的分区,导致 Windows 存储空间(Storage Spaces)的元数据残留所致。 系统仍然认为这些磁盘属于某个旧的存储池配置,因此拒绝将其加入新的存储池。 🛠️ 解决方案步骤 请按顺序执行以下步骤,在 Windows PowerShell(管理员) 中操作。 步骤 1:查看磁盘状态 首先,我们需要确认磁盘的当前状态。打开管理员身份的 PowerShell,输入以下命令: Get-PhysicalDiskml7ykbna.png图片 在返回的结果中,重点关注 CanPool 这一列。 False:表示磁盘目前无法被加入新的存储池。 True:表示磁盘可用。 如果你的目标磁盘的 CanPool 显示为 False,那么请继续下一步。 步骤 2:定位目标磁盘 从上一条命令的输出中,找到你想要修复的磁盘,并记录下它的 SerialNumber(序列号)。然后运行以下命令(请将 xxxxx 替换为实际的序列号): Get-PhysicalDisk -SerialNumber xxxxxml7yiiw7.png图片 此命令用于确认你定位到了正确的磁盘。 步骤 3:重置磁盘状态 这是最关键的一步。运行重置命令: Reset-PhysicalDisk运行后,PowerShell 会交互式地提示你输入参数: 位于命令管道位置 1 的 cmdlet Reset-PhysicalDisk 请为以下参数提供值: FriendlyName: 请注意: 这里需要输入的是磁盘的 FriendlyName(硬盘名称),而不是 SerialNumber(序列号)。 FriendlyName 同样可以在 步骤1 的 Get-PhysicalDisk 命令输出中找到,通常是类似 “ATA ST2000DM008-2FR1” 或 “NVMe Samsung SSD 970” 这样的型号描述。正确输入 FriendlyName 后按回车。 步骤 4:验证修复结果 重置命令执行完毕后,再次运行最初的检查命令: Get-PhysicalDisk此时,检查目标磁盘的 CanPool 属性。如果操作成功,它应该已经从 False 变为 True。 ✅ 完成 现在,你可以返回 Windows “存储空间” 管理界面,尝试重新创建存储池或向现有存储池添加驱动器了。问题应该已经得到解决。 ⚠️ 重要提醒 数据无价:在执行 Reset-PhysicalDisk 操作前,请务必确保目标磁盘上没有你需要保留的数据。此操作旨在清除磁盘上的存储池元数据,虽然主要影响分区信息,但仍属于磁盘级操作。 管理员权限:所有 PowerShell 命令都必须在 “以管理员身份运行” 的窗口中执行。 适用范围:此方法主要解决因“旧存储池元数据残留”导致的磁盘无法被复用问题。如果是由物理连接、驱动器故障或驱动程序引起的问题,则需要检查硬件和驱动。 希望这篇教程能帮助你顺利解决问题!如果依然遇到困难,欢迎在评论区留言讨论。 -
常用命令 windows 命令 1.刷新 DNS 缓存: ipconfig /flushdns2.windows系统修复: 依次输入,不要一次性复制粘贴: Dism.exe /Online /Cleanup-Image /CheckHealthDISM.exe /Online /Cleanup-image /Scanhealthsfc /scannowLinux 命令 一键更换源脚本 bash <(curl -sSL https://linuxmirrors.cn/main.sh)查看登陆 ssh 成功记录 last查看登陆 ssh 失败记录 lastb强制重启 reboot -nf用途:某些情况下 Linux 服务器系统在出现致命错误需要远程进行重启,通过常规的 reboot、init 6 等方法无法正常重启(例如重启时卡在驱动程序里等情况) 睿频 ⚠️ 虚拟化程度高的普通云主机可能无法完全控制睿频功能,需使用裸金属服务器或专用宿主机才能获得完整硬件特性支持。 查看睿频状态 cat /sys/devices/system/cpu/intel_pstate/no_turbo输出 0 表示已启用睿频。 输出 1 表示禁用了睿频。 开启睿频 echo 0 > /sys/devices/system/cpu/intel_pstate/no_turbo查看频率 cat /proc/cpuinfo | grep "cpu MHz"